RE: wiki with user link - Added by Robin Wagner about 6 years ago

Hi Zack,

using the "@" sign to reference users works exclusively for work package descriptions and comments, not for wiki pages.

If you added some members to your project, you can then add a comment to a work package and reference those users by entering the "@" sign. You will then see a list of potential users to reference which you can choose from.

RE: wiki with user link - Added by Zack Glennie about 6 years ago

I think I understand. Your reply is helpful-- I now understand that the @mention feature simply is not part of the Wiki editor at all.

According the docs, the Work Package Comment editor is similar, but not identical, to the wiki page editor (see "Full vs constrained editor" on the Wiki documentation).

When I described the issue, I had tried it in both places. It sounds like when it wasn't working in the Wiki, that was because of the limitation you're describing, and when it wasn't working in the Work Package Comment editor, it was for a different reason: the user who I was trying to @mention was not connected to the project that I was commenting on.

It looks like we have these strategies for mentioning a user:

             @mention user:"username" user#id
Work Package Description and Comments members of this project       any user any user
Others (Wiki, Meetings, Project Overviews...)                   none       any user any user
